In Andalusian fowl, B is the gene for black plumage (head feathers) and B' (pronounced "B prime") is the gene for white plumage.

These genes, however, show incomplete dominance. The heterozygous (BB') condition results in blue plumage. List the genotypic and phenotypic ratios expected from the following crosses: a) black x blue b) blue x blue c) blue x white

Answer:

a. Phenotypic and Genotypic ratio= 1:1

b. Phenotypic and Genotypic ratio= 1:2:1

c. Phenotypic and Genotypic ratio= 1:1

Explanation:

The crosses are monohybrid involving a single gene coding for plumage color in Andalusian fowl. The alleles for this gene exhibit incomplete dominance, a genetic scenario whereby an allele does not completely mask the expression of another, instead it blends with it forming an intermediate phenotype.

In this case, allele B is for black plumage

allele B' is for white plumage

In an heterozygous state i.e. combined allelic state (BB'), an intermediate blue plumage is formed.

A black fowl will possess a genotype BB

A blue fowl will possess a genotype BB'

A white fowl will possess a genotype B'B'

In the crosses between these fowls as highlighted in the question above (see attached image), the following genotypic and phenotypic ratio will be produced by the resulting offsprings.

a) Black (BB) × Blue (BB') : 1:1 (2 Black, 2 Blue)

b) Blue (BB') × Blue (BB') : 1:2:1 (1 Black, 2 Blue, 1 White)

c) Blue (BB') × White (B'B') : 1:1 (2 Blue, 2 White)

Vaccination or immunization is the process which helps in developing the immunity (adaptive) against a particular pathogen or microorganism.

It includes the administration of antigen, weakened or heat-killed microorganism (such as flu virus) into the patients body. Body's immune system produces naive B and T cells to eliminate the antigen.

This encounter enables the immune system to produce memory B and T cells against that particular pathogen.

In future, whenever the same antigen enters the body, the immune system gets activated quickly due to the presence of memory cells. It enables the body to produce more effective secondary response against the pathogen.

Mary consumes approximately 1800 kcalories per day. if she wants to consume 15% of her kcalories from protein, how many grams wo
Likurg_2 [28]
<span>The answer should be 67.5gram

If Mary wants to consume 15% of her kcalories from protein, then the target calorie would be: 15% * </span><span>1800 kcal= 270kcal.
Every gram of protein will give about 4 kcal of energy. So, the protein needed in gram would be: 270kcal / (4kcal/gram)= 67.5 gram</span>
